
Customer Success Implementation Manager
Sandler Partners
full-time
Posted on:
Location Type: Remote
Location: United States
Visit company websiteExplore more
About the role
- The Customer Success Implementation Manager is responsible for accelerating franchisee success through high-touch onboarding and ongoing enablement.
- Ensure both new and tenured franchisees adopt Sandler’s systems, tools, and best practices.
- Lead franchisee implementation across 10+ core platforms.
- Deliver structured onboarding for new owners.
- Provide proactive enablement to established franchises who want to scale, modernize, or improve execution.
- Develop, update, and maintain onboarding content.
- Co-host bi-monthly onboarding cohorts and lead weekly 1:1 onboarding sessions with new franchisees.
- Support Initial Training in Baltimore (bi-monthly travel required).
Requirements
- 5+ years in Customer Success, Franchise Enablement, Implementation, Onboarding, Training, or related roles.
- CRM / marketing automation experience (HubSpot strongly preferred).
- Strong command of MS office suite.
- Strong technical aptitude across multi-platform environments.
- Proven ability to train, present, and guide users through adoption in both virtual and in-person settings.
- High organizational discipline; able to manage multiple franchise “builds” simultaneously.
- Excellent communication, coaching, and relationship-management skills.
Benefits
- Health insurance
- Retirement plans
- Flexible work arrangements
- Professional development
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
Customer SuccessFranchise EnablementImplementationOnboardingTrainingCRMMarketing AutomationTechnical AptitudeMulti-platform EnvironmentsContent Development
Soft skills
CommunicationCoachingRelationship ManagementOrganizational DisciplineTrainingPresentationGuidanceProactive EnablementHigh-touch OnboardingLeadership